With so many travelers finding themselves transfixed by Utila’s reefs and low-key lifestyle, plenty of apartments are up for rent. Prices can range anywhere from US$200–600, depending on what kind of place you’re looking for, but average places go for US$400–500 a month for a one-bedroom. Among the hotels offering long-term rentals are Cooper’s Inn (US$400/month for a one-bedroom, US$550/month for a two-bedroom) as well as Freddy’s Place and Countryside Inn.
Bananaville Apartments (tel. 504/3369-2298, rm.paradisecove [at] gmail [dot] com) is one recommended lodging, in a residential area roughly 15 minutes walk from the municipal dock. The one-bedroom apartments rent for US$500 per month, and two single beds can be added to squeeze in four people if needed. Monthly renters are preferred, but weekly renters are considered based on availability, at the rate of US$150 per week.
Sandstone Apartments (tel. 504/425-3692), out on the point, offers rentals for US$450–800 per month, while a one-bedroom at the newly constructed Caribbean Dreams is US$450 a month. Many other places can be found by asking around, particularly through dive masters and instructors, or on www.aboututila.com.
